More Than a Log Book—A Framework for Cognitive Alignment
What sets Day Trading Journal KDP Interiors apart from generic trade logs is its embedded cognitive scaffolding. Consider three interlocking dimensions it supports:
- Behavioral calibration — Through dedicated emotional tracking (before, during, and after each trade), users begin identifying recurring psychological triggers: impatience after a win, hesitation after a loss, overconfidence following a streak. These aren’t abstract concepts—they’re data points tied to specific entries, making patterns undeniable.
- Strategic fidelity — The Strategy Setup Notes section forces traders to articulate *why* they entered—not just what they saw on the chart, but which rule or setup triggered action. Over time, this surfaces misalignment: e.g., taking a “breakout” trade that actually violated one’s own pre-defined volume or momentum filters.
- Operational rigor — With fields for entry/exit prices, position size, stop-loss placement, fees, and net P&L, the journal eliminates post-trade guesswork. This level of granularity matters when calculating expectancy, win rate, and average risk-reward ratios—metrics that inform long-term capital allocation, not just daily P&L.
This triad—behavior, strategy, operations—is rarely addressed holistically in free templates or apps that prioritize speed over substance. Yet it’s precisely this integration that enables traders to move from reactive execution to proactive design.
